    White House Memo Urges Federal Agencies to Prepare for Post-Quantum Cryptography

    November 20, 2022 - The White House Office of Management and Budget (OMB) has issued a new memorandum that could reshape federal cybersecurity for the coming quantum era. OMB Memorandum M-23-02, titled "Migrating to Post-Quantum Cryptography," was released on November 18, 2022 and directs U.S. federal agencies to begin the urgent process of preparing their systems for post-quantum cryptography (PQC).…

    NSA Unveils CNSA 2.0 Post-Quantum Algorithm Suite

    The U.S. National Security Agency (NSA) has officially announced the release of the Commercial National Security Algorithm Suite 2.0 (CNSA 2.0), a new set of cryptographic standards designed to protect sensitive systems against future quantum-enabled cyber threats.     White House – Quantum Related National Security Memorandum

    On May 4, 2022, the White House issued a significant policy directive through the “National Security Memorandum on Promoting United States Leadership in Quantum Computing While Mitigating Risks to Vulnerable Cryptographic Systems” or NSM-10. The memorandum highlights the urgency of developing quantum-resistant cryptographic systems to protect against potential threats posed by quantum computers, which could compromise current cryptographic defenses.     U.S. National Quantum Initiative Act

    On December 21, 2018, the United States solidified its commitment to quantum technology advancement by enacting the H.R.6227 – National Quantum Initiative Act. Passed with near-unanimous support from both houses of Congress, this landmark legislation outlines a comprehensive 10-year plan aimed at maintaining and enhancing U.S. leadership in quantum technologies.
